
Pope Leo XIV Calls for Global Support in Gaza Reconstruction Efforts
Pope Leo XIV has issued a formal appeal to international authorities to provide aid and support for the reconstruction of Gaza. The Pope emphasized the ongoing humanitarian suffering of the region's population.
Pope Leo XIV has publicly called upon world leaders and international authorities to assist in the reconstruction of Gaza. In his recent appeal, the pontiff highlighted the dire conditions faced by residents, noting that the population is 'still suffering' as a result of ongoing instability and conflict.
While the Pope’s message focuses on the necessity of global humanitarian intervention, the report from Al Jazeera frames the appeal as a direct plea for structural rebuilding. The statement serves as a continuation of the Vatican's recent diplomatic focus on conflict zones, though specific details regarding the proposed mechanism for aid delivery or the political conditions for reconstruction remain unaddressed in the current discourse. The appeal underscores a growing international pressure to transition from emergency relief to long-term recovery efforts in the territory, though the path to such reconstruction remains complex given the current geopolitical climate.
